使用PostgreSQL列出所有数据库
2023.11.07 05:11浏览量:951简介:如何使用PostgreSQL列出所有数据库
如何使用PostgreSQL列出所有数据库
PostgreSQL是一种功能强大的开源关系型数据库管理系统(RDBMS),广泛应用于各种企业和应用中。在使用PostgreSQL时,有时候需要列出所有可用的数据库。以下是如何使用PostgreSQL列出所有数据库的步骤:
- 连接到PostgreSQL服务器
首先,需要使用合适的客户端工具连接到PostgreSQL服务器。常见的客户端工具包括pgAdmin、psql命令行工具和图形界面工具,如DataGrip、Navicat等。确保已经安装并正确配置了PostgreSQL服务器,并具备适当的权限来访问数据库。 - 使用SQL查询列出所有数据库
在成功连接到PostgreSQL服务器后,可以使用SQL查询来列出所有数据库。在命令行或客户端工具中输入以下SQL语句:
或者\l
第一个SQL查询SELECT datname FROM pg_database;
\l
是pgAdmin和psql命令行工具中常用的命令,用于列出所有数据库。而第二个SQL查询是通过查询pg_database系统目录来获取所有数据库的名称。 - 解释结果
执行上述SQL查询后,将列出所有可用的数据库名称。每个数据库名称将作为一个独立的行显示。可以查看每个数据库的详细信息,如数据库模式、大小等。 - 注意事项
在执行上述操作时,确保具有足够的权限来访问数据库信息。通常,需要具有超级用户或管理员权限才能查看所有数据库列表。此外,确保已经正确配置了连接参数,包括主机、端口、用户名和密码等。
总结:
通过以上步骤,您可以使用PostgreSQL列出所有数据库。首先连接到PostgreSQL服务器,然后使用适当的SQL查询来获取数据库列表。执行查询后,将显示所有可用的数据库名称。请注意,需要具有足够的权限才能执行此操作,并确保正确配置连接参数。
发表评论
登录后可评论,请前往 登录 或 注册